Manufacturing Development Customer Engineering (MDCE) is Intel's newest organization within Intel Foundry Technology Manufacturing (FTM). We bridge the critical gap between Technology Development (TD) and High Volume Manufacturing (HVM), advancing technology nodes from initial product qualification to high-yield production across multiple products while enhancing technologies for our foundry customers. MDCE is also chartered to develop new technologies on mature node infrastructure to bring new solutions to new customers at reliable yield and performance and low cost, and this is where you are going to play a role.
MDCE engineers in Ireland work within F34 at Leixlip, Ireland. F34 opened in 2023 and began high-volume production of Intel 4 technology. This milestone also represents the deployment by Intel of extreme ultraviolet lithography in high-volume manufacturing for the first time globally. Since 1989, Intel has invested more than 30 billion in Ireland creating the most advanced industrial campus in Europe, and Intel Ireland is home to Europe's most advanced high scale semi-conductor foundry fab.
